Transaction 180e7236e191fc4995f1e97b50a2b06e67919af93ae8fb59ef2c4bd63db3370a

3 Input
2 Outputs
  • 180e7236e191fc4995f1e97b50a2b06e67919af93ae8fb59ef2c4bd63db3370a:0
  • value  4563807
    address  3KTGUhyF6R5wsHfjYF5EvdEw8AmaPWK4hV
  • 180e7236e191fc4995f1e97b50a2b06e67919af93ae8fb59ef2c4bd63db3370a:1
  • value  559773
    address  bc1q8rua927lce7avnwfajtlefd3g002lxwgng3f4w